Is ๐น๐ญ Flag of Thailand Emoji Appropriate at Work?
Using ๐น๐ญ at work is generally fine if your workplace culture is super casual and you're talking about travel, but it's rarely appropriate in formal communications. Read the room before you send it.

๐๐น๐ญThis one clearly means 'Thai food' or 'eating Thai food.' Itโs often used in Instagram captions for food pics, TikTok reviews of Thai restaurants, or in texts when someoneโs craving Pad Thai. It highlights the delicious culinary aspect of Thailand.
๐ด๐๐น๐ญThis combination screams 'beach vacation in Thailand.' It's used to evoke the sunny, tropical vibes of Thailand's famous islands and coastal areas. You'll see it in aspirational posts, travel itineraries, or as a reaction to stunning beach photos from the region.
โจ๐น๐ญThis combo often means 'dreaming of Thailand' or 'manifesting a trip to Thailand.' The โจ adds a touch of magic and aspiration, indicating that Thailand is a desired destination or a goal. It's common in TikToks about bucket lists or Instagram posts sharing travel dreams.

What does ๐น๐ญ mean from a girl?โพ
Real talk: if a girl sends ๐น๐ญ, she's almost always talking about Thailand literally. It could be about a trip she wants to take, a recent vacation, or something cool she saw about Thai culture or food. Context is key, but it's usually not a coded message.
What does ๐น๐ญ mean in texting?โพ
In texting, ๐น๐ญ is pretty much a direct reference to Thailand. People use it to talk about travel plans, share experiences from a trip, or express their love for Thai cuisine. It's generally straightforward, not a secret slang.
Is ๐น๐ญ flirty or friendly?โพ
๐น๐ญ is usually friendly and aspirational. If it feels flirty from a crush, itโs probably more about hinting at shared travel dreams than a direct come-on. From a friend, itโs just about travel or food. Depends heavily on who sent it and your relationship with them.
